Oh, and I think I forgot to mention this important stuff about the Dolathi to help their race make sense in context:

Dolathi can switch gender, so many of them are bisexual and switch genders quite a lot between forms, which caused one playtester's character who insisted on visiting the "Dolathi Bathhouse" to run away :)

Dolathi cannot reproduce in their featureless form, instead shifting into an alternate form and reproducing with another Dolathi or a normal member of the assumed race. Either way, the result is a Dolathi, but if the mother is not a Dolathi, she oddly does not swell up and become bloated with child, although experiencing all the other effects of pregnancy. If the mother is a non-Dolathi, the Dolathi will briefly appear as a genetic clone of the mother, albeit an infant, before it can control its powers. These Dolathi are more likely to develop a distinctly feminine personality and consider themselves to be women. And then there are some Dolathi that just prefer male forms, although they are less common.
